Frequently Asked Questions

What does The Carolyn E Wylie Center For Children Youth & Families do?

The Carolyn E Wylie Center For Children Youth & Families is a human services nonprofit organization based in California. It is classified under NTEE code P28 and is registered as a 501(c) tax-exempt organization with the IRS.

Is The Carolyn E Wylie Center For Children Youth & Families financially healthy?

Based on our 9-metric Financial Health Score model, The Carolyn E Wylie Center For Children Youth & Families has a score of 44/100 (Grade: C). This score evaluates working capital, surplus consistency, debt ratio, revenue trends, program spending, fundraising efficiency, executive compensation, revenue diversification, and vulnerability indicators.
